Why Intiman Theatre is a fun option when searching for things to do near me with friends and family

Intiman Theatre, located in Seattle, Washington, offers an enriching meeting place for friends who love theater and cultural experiences. Founded in 1972 in a small Kirkland venue, Intiman has grown into a cornerstone of Seattle's performing arts scene, housed in the historic Seattle Playhouse at Seattle Center. With a strong reputation for classic plays and innovative contemporary productions, it appeals to a wide audience of theatre enthusiasts. Its historic evolution from a modest 65-seat theatre into a professional company awarded the Regional Theatre Tony Award in 2006 highlights Intiman's commitment to high-quality performances and community engagement. The theatre not only showcases productions by a talented ensemble cast but also integrates stunning scenic designs, such as captivating uses of light and water in recent shows, enhancing the immersive experience. Beyond performances, Intiman actively contributes to arts education through high school and college programs, focusing on workforce development in the creative industries. How does the history of Intiman Theatre enhance the group experience?

The rich history of Intiman Theatre adds depth and context that elevates the group experience. Founded in 1972 by Fulbright scholar Margaret Booker, Intiman began in a modest 65-seat venue in Kirkland and gradually expanded through dedication to high-quality productions and community engagement. This trajectory of growth, culminating in the move to its current home at the historic Seattle Playhouse, embodies a legacy of artistic resilience and innovation. Groups who attend a show are participating in a longstanding tradition that has nurtured Seattle’s theatrical community and cultivated a reputation that earned Intiman a Regional Theatre Tony Award – a mark of national excellence.
